The Microtia Ear

Microtia is a congenital ear deformity affecting the external ear. Microtia affects about 1 in 8,000 children, so it not a common birth defect, but neither is it rare. Microtia can affect either one or both ears, but the majority of children, have only one ear affected. Microtia literally means "Little Ear." In many cases, the outer ear is so underdeveloped that the description is apt. But, Microtia can also affect the ear canal, ear drum and ear bones. When the ear structure is affected in addition to the outer ear, Atresia Microtia can be diagnosed. Microtia is commonly accompanied by Atresia because the inner and outer ears develop together. The appearance of the outer ear makes diagnosing Microtia fairly easy. Diagnosing the hearing loss, however, requires testing.

Hearing Loss

Children born with Microtia are tested at birth for hearing loss. Hearing loss usually accompanies Microtia because sound doesn't have an adequate pathway to the inner ear. Parents should keep the results of this hearing test as a baseline because as the child grows, the ear's shape changes and so, too, the ability to hear could change. Because Microtia typically affects only one ear, a complete hearing loss is rare. In most cases, some form of hearing aid and speech therapy is very affective.Treatment Options For Microtia


Microtia Treatments

Because Microtia causes outer ear deformity, medical treatment tries to reshape the outer ear. The main methods of ear reshaping include ear prosthesis, rib cartilage grafts, and implants. It's best to wait until the child is older than six before treatment begins. The child must be mature enough to co-operate with the treatment, and the child's ear must be grown enough to make the surgery useful.

An ear prosthesis is built out of flesh-colored silicone. With today's technology, the ear prosthesis looks like a realistic ear. In fact, it can look more real than the results from ear-reshaping surgery. An ear prosthesis requires only a few minutes of care each day. The only disadvantages to the prosthesis are the child's knowledge that the ear isn't real and the small amount of care it requires. To combat the social and emotional effects of Microtia, parents sometimes fit their children prosthesis before they start kindergarten.

Surgeons often graft pieces of the child's own rib cartilage to the Microtia ear and reshape it to look like a more normal ear. The child's cartilage then continues to grow as the child grows. This allows the ear graft to grown into an adult size with the child.

Ear implants require reconstructive surgery. This surgery is often done on an outpatient basis. The child's tissue is grown into a polyethylene plastic implant. The surgeon then constructs the new ear, usually in one surgery. Minor adjustments are made a few months later in a second surgery, if they are necessary. The advantage to the rib cartilage graft and the ear implant is that they both use the child's own tissue.

Because is not particularly rare, doctors and surgeons have a great deal of knowledge and experience with this birth defect. With that experience and today's medical advances, parents can rest assured that their children born with Microtia can live active lives.
